From 422c0d61d591cbfb70f029e13505fb437e169d68 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Jeff Garzik Date: Mon, 24 Oct 2005 18:05:09 -0400 Subject: [SCSI] use scmd_id(), scmd_channel() throughout code Wrap a highly common idiom. Makes the code easier to read, helps pave the way for sdev->{id,channel} removal, and adds a token that can easily by grepped-for in the future. There are a couple sdev_id() and scmd_printk() updates thrown in as well.
